Brooks Macdonald is an integrated wealth management group comprising of discretionary asset management, fund management, a financial advisory and employee benefits consultancy and estate management. The Group was founded in 1991 and began trading on AIM in 2005. As of 30 June 2018, the company has discretionary funds under management of £12.4 billion. Through their core divisions, Brooks Macdonald offer a range of investment management services and advice to individuals, pension funds, institutions, charities and trusts. They also provide offshore fund management and administration services and act as fund manage to regulated OEICs, providing specialist funds in the property and absolute return sectors as well as managing property assets on behalf of these funds and other clients. They have offices across the UK and Channel Islands, including London, Wales, Scotland, East Anglia, Guernsey, Hampshire, Jersey, Leamington Spa, Manchester, Taunton, Tunbridge Wells and York.
My organisation encourages charitable activities
The Brooks Macdonald Foundation was established in 2011 as a charitable trust. Funds are generated from corporate donations, an employee Give as You Earn Scheme, fundraising events and donations from friends, family and clients.
I believe I can make a valuable contribution to the success of this organisation
The company have also introduced 'Thirsty Thursday', which occurs monthly to improve interaction between teams in the ever expanding London office and general socialising in the regions.
My team is fun to work with
Brooks Macdonald endeavour to ease stress by holding regular collaborative events, including annual Christmas mulled wine and mince pie gatherings, a Christmas jumper competition, and frequent cakes and goodies for staff.
